Customer Question

My dog ate a mushroom in the backyard. Within 5 minutes she threw up, I believe, all the mushroom and continued to throw up a yellow and white foaming substance. She has drank some water and she seems alert. Should I take her into the emergency clinic?

Hello,I am so sorry your little on is having some trouble.

 

Mushroom poisoning occurs as a result of ingesting toxic mushrooms. Not all mushrooms are poisonous, but each type of poisonous mushroom can cause different signs of illness.

Depending on the type of mushroom problems with the liver, kidneys and a drop in blood glucose may be seen within 24-48 hours. Some mushrooms can be fatal

 

Because these can cause so many problems and some mushrooms are potentially fatal I would suggest having her seen this morning by your regular vet so you do not end up in the ER this evening.Here is additional information on Mushroom toxicity.
